How to Manage Soil Ph for Optimal Stone Fruit Tree Growth

Managing soil pH is essential for the healthy growth of stone fruit trees such as peaches, plums, cherries, and apricots. Proper soil pH ensures that nutrients are available to the trees and prevents deficiencies that can stunt growth or cause diseases.

Understanding Soil pH

Soil pH measures the acidity or alkalinity of the soil on a scale from 0 to 14. A pH of 7 is neutral. Most stone fruit trees thrive in slightly acidic to neutral soils, typically between 6.0 and 7.0. When soil pH falls outside this range, nutrient uptake can be hindered, leading to poor growth and fruit production.

Testing Soil pH

Regular soil testing is crucial for effective pH management. You can purchase a soil testing kit or hire a professional service. Testing should be done annually, especially before planting or after significant weather changes, to monitor soil health.

How to Adjust Soil pH

  • To raise soil pH (make it more alkaline): Add lime (calcium carbonate). Apply according to the package instructions based on your soil test results.
  • To lower soil pH (make it more acidic): Incorporate elemental sulfur or acidifying organic matter like pine needles or peat moss.
  • Timing: Adjust pH during the dormant season for best results.

Additional Tips for Soil pH Management

Consistent monitoring and gradual adjustments are key. Avoid large pH changes at once, as they can stress the trees. Use organic matter to improve soil structure and health, which can also help stabilize pH levels. Mulching around the base of the trees can retain moisture and support healthy root development.
